http://nsp-blurbs.s3-website-us-west-2.amazonaws.com/9780865719194_excerpt.pdf Webb5 jan. 2024 · Elderberry’s Culinary Uses. Elderberries and elderflowers have a wide range of culinary uses. The flowers (also called “blow”) are often used in champagne, cordials, pickles, wine, jam, teas, and vinegar. They’re also commonly found in shrubs, Colonial-era beverages featuring herb-infused vinegar-based syrups.
